Bluestar Alliance Acquires Palm Angels
February 11, 2025
Bluestar Alliance LLC has acquired luxury streetwear brand Palm Angels, adding the label to its portfolio of premium fashion and lifestyle brands. The deal furthers Bluestar's strategic expansion into the high-end streetwear and luxury fashion sectors; founder Francesco Ragazzi said he is stepping away as the brand enters a new chapter.

Bluestar Alliance Acquires Off-White LLC from LVMH
September 30, 2024
Consumer Products
Bluestar Alliance, LLC has acquired Off-White LLC, the company that owns the Off-White brand, from LVMH; terms were not disclosed. Bluestar — joined in related financing and co-investment activity by Hilco Global and TPG Angelo Gordon — said it will invest in and build on Virgil Abloh’s legacy while leveraging its global brand-management capabilities.

Bluestar Alliance Acquires Dickies Brand from VF Corporation
November 12, 2025
Consumer Products
Bluestar Alliance has completed the acquisition of the Dickies workwear and lifestyle brand from VF Corporation. The purchase adds a century-old heritage apparel brand to Bluestar's youth-luxury portfolio and is intended to accelerate Dickies' global expansion across new categories and markets, particularly in EMEA and APAC.

Bluestar Alliance Acquires Scotch & Soda
March 27, 2023
Retail
Bluestar Alliance, a New York–based brand management firm, has acquired Amsterdam-based fashion brand Scotch & Soda from the bankrupt entities to preserve the brand and continue operations across key markets. Terms were not disclosed; the deal follows Scotch & Soda's bankruptcy filing in the Netherlands after severe cash-flow issues and will allow Bluestar to integrate the label into its portfolio and stabilise selected retail operations.

Palmex and Benestar Brands Merge; Wind Point Majority, Highlander Retains Minority; Pretzilla Spun Out
December 11, 2023
Food & Beverage
Wind Point Partners’ portfolio company Palmex has merged with Highlander Partners’ portfolio company Benestar Brands to form a combined North American salty-snack platform, with Wind Point as the majority shareholder and Highlander retaining a significant minority stake. Pretzilla, Benestar’s pretzel bread business, was spun out as a standalone entity owned by Highlander and Pretzilla management; the combined business will be led by Jose Luis Prado and will operate eight facilities with more than 1,400 employees.

Emerald Textiles Acquires West Coast Assets of Angelica Corporation
December 4, 2021
Healthcare Services
Emerald Textiles, a portfolio company of Pacific Avenue Capital Partners, acquired the West Coast assets of Angelica Corporation, including nine facilities that expand Emerald into Phoenix and Las Vegas and strengthen its Northern and Southern California footprint. The deal grows Emerald's network to 15 plants and 2 service depots (serving nearly 2,000 customer sites) and further establishes the company as the largest healthcare linen services provider in the Western United States.

Highline Warren Acquires BlueDevil Products
January 12, 2021
Automotive
Highline Warren, a Memphis-based manufacturer and distributor of automotive consumable products and a portfolio company of Pritzker Private Capital, has acquired BlueDevil Products from The Starco Group. The deal adds the BlueDevil, Red Angel, and PJ1 brands to Highline Warren’s portfolio to expand its automotive aftermarket product offerings and distribution reach.
